Bridging the Gap in Peripheral Nerve Repair.

Donato Perretta, Steven Green

    Bulletin of the Hospital for Joint Disease (2013)
    |February 20, 2017
    PubMed
    Summary

    This review covers peripheral nerve injuries, discussing anatomy, regeneration biology, and repair methods. It provides evidence-based recommendations for surgical treatment of these challenging hand injuries.

    Area of Science:

    • Orthopedics
    • Neurosurgery
    • Regenerative Medicine

    Background:

    • Peripheral nerve injuries (PNI) pose significant challenges in hand surgery.
    • Understanding nerve anatomy and injury types is crucial for effective treatment.
    • The biology of nerve regeneration is complex and central to recovery.

    Purpose of the Study:

    • To provide a comprehensive overview of peripheral nerve injuries.
    • To critically appraise current literature on nerve repair techniques.
    • To formulate evidence-based recommendations for surgical management.

    Main Methods:

    • Historical review of peripheral nerve injury management.
    • Detailed discussion of nerve anatomy and injury classifications.
    • Critical appraisal of recent literature on nerve regeneration and repair methods.
